1package wugnot
2
3import (
4 "chain"
5 "chain/banker"
6 "chain/runtime"
7 "chain/runtime/unsafe"
8 "strings"
9
10 "gno.land/p/demo/tokens/grc20"
11 "gno.land/p/nt/ufmt/v0"
12 "gno.land/r/demo/defi/grc20reg"
13)
14
15var (
16 Token *grc20.Token
17 adm *grc20.PrivateLedger
18)
19
20const (
21 ugnotMinDeposit int64 = 1000
22 wugnotMinDeposit int64 = 1
23)
24
25func init(cur realm) {
26 // wugnot only ever creates this one token, so id 0 can't collide.
27 Token, adm = grc20.NewToken("wrapped GNOT", "wugnot", 0, 0, cur)
28 grc20reg.Register(cross(cur), Token, "")
29}
30
31func Deposit(cur realm) {
32 // Prevent cross-realm MITM: without this, an intermediary could
33 // deposit on behalf of the caller and mint wugnot to itself
34 // instead of the actual sender.
35 runtime.AssertOriginCall()
36 caller := cur.Previous().Address()
37 sent := unsafe.OriginSend()
38 amount := sent.AmountOf("ugnot")
39
40 require(int64(amount) >= ugnotMinDeposit, ufmt.Sprintf("Deposit below minimum: %d/%d ugnot.", amount, ugnotMinDeposit))
41
42 checkErr(adm.Mint(caller, int64(amount)))
43}
44
45func Withdraw(cur realm, amount int64) {
46 runtime.AssertOriginCall()
47 require(amount >= wugnotMinDeposit, ufmt.Sprintf("Deposit below minimum: %d/%d wugnot.", amount, wugnotMinDeposit))
48
49 caller := cur.Previous().Address()
50 pkgaddr := cur.Address()
51 callerBal := Token.BalanceOf(caller)
52 require(amount <= callerBal, ufmt.Sprintf("Insufficient balance: %d available, %d needed.", callerBal, amount))
53
54 // send swapped ugnots to qcaller
55 stdBanker := banker.NewBanker(banker.BankerTypeRealmSend, cur)
56 send := chain.Coins{{"ugnot", int64(amount)}}
57 stdBanker.SendCoins(pkgaddr, caller, send)
58 checkErr(adm.Burn(caller, amount))
59}
60
61func Render(path string) string {
62 parts := strings.Split(path, "/")
63 c := len(parts)
64
65 switch {
66 case path == "":
67 return Token.RenderHome()
68 case c == 2 && parts[0] == "balance":
69 owner := address(parts[1])
70 balance := Token.BalanceOf(owner)
71 return ufmt.Sprintf("%d", balance)
72 default:
73 return "404"
74 }
75}
76
77func TotalSupply() int64 {
78 return Token.TotalSupply()
79}
80
81func BalanceOf(owner address) int64 {
82 return Token.BalanceOf(owner)
83}
84
85func Allowance(owner, spender address) int64 {
86 return Token.Allowance(owner, spender)
87}
88
89func Transfer(cur realm, to address, amount int64) {
90 userTeller := Token.CallerTeller()
91 checkErr(userTeller.Transfer(0, cur, to, amount))
92}
93
94func Approve(cur realm, spender address, amount int64) {
95 userTeller := Token.CallerTeller()
96 checkErr(userTeller.Approve(0, cur, spender, amount))
97}
98
99func TransferFrom(cur realm, from, to address, amount int64) {
100 userTeller := Token.CallerTeller()
101 checkErr(userTeller.TransferFrom(0, cur, from, to, amount))
102}
103
104func require(condition bool, msg string) {
105 if !condition {
106 panic(msg)
107 }
108}
109
110func checkErr(err error) {
111 if err != nil {
112 panic(err)
113 }
114}
